TV Bro:重新定义智能电视上网体验的专业浏览器解决方案
【免费下载链接】tv-broSimple web browser for android optimized to use with TV remote项目地址: https://gitcode.com/gh_mirrors/tv/tv-bro
智能电视拥有卓越的显示能力,却常常受限于传统浏览器的交互设计。TV Bro是一款专门为Android电视环境优化的开源浏览器,通过创新的遥控器交互范式,让大屏设备真正成为家庭数字生活的核心枢纽。
🎯 智能电视浏览体验的革新突破
传统浏览器移植到电视环境面临多重挑战:界面元素难以在远距离观看时辨识、导航逻辑与遥控器操作习惯不匹配、性能优化不足导致用户体验下降。TV Bro从底层架构出发,彻底重构了电视浏览的交互模式:
大屏交互的重新设计
TV Bro采用"焦点驱动导航"系统,用户只需使用遥控器方向键即可在网页元素间精准移动焦点。这种设计不仅符合电视遥控器的物理特性,还显著降低了操作复杂度,让各年龄段用户都能轻松上手。
性能与功能的平衡优化
在保持轻量级架构的同时,TV Bro提供了完整的功能体系:
- 多标签页管理系统:支持同时打开多个网页,实现高效的任务切换
- 智能下载管理器:后台下载不影响前台浏览操作
- 语音搜索集成:通过遥控器麦克风实现快速内容检索
- 隐私保护模式:提供不留痕迹的安全浏览环境
TV Bro主界面展示维基百科多语言选择页面,顶部工具栏和底部操作按钮专为遥控器优化设计
📱 三大安装途径满足不同需求场景
应用商店直接安装(推荐方式)
在智能电视的Google Play商店中搜索"TV Bro",点击安装即可开始使用。这种方式最为便捷,能够自动获取版本更新和安全补丁。
手动APK文件安装(适用于无Google服务环境)
对于没有Google服务的设备,可通过以下步骤完成安装:
- 从项目仓库下载最新版本的APK文件
- 通过U盘或网络传输将文件复制到电视设备
- 在电视上使用文件管理器找到并安装APK文件
源代码编译安装(开发者选项)
技术爱好者可以通过以下命令获取完整源代码:
git clone https://gitcode.com/gh_mirrors/tv/tv-bro cd tv-bro # 根据项目文档进行构建配置🚀 快速入门与核心功能配置指南
首次启动的优化设置建议
初次使用TV Bro时,推荐进行以下配置以获得最佳体验:
| 配置项目 | 推荐设置 | 效果说明 |
|---|---|---|
| 默认搜索引擎 | 根据所在地区选择 | 提升搜索准确性和响应速度 |
| 字体显示大小 | 中等至大号 | 确保远距离观看时的可读性 |
| 广告拦截功能 | 开启状态 | 减少干扰内容,提升页面加载效率 |
| 主页快捷入口 | 常用网站集合 | 实现高频网站的快速访问 |
核心操作逻辑解析
TV Bro的操作逻辑经过精心设计,用户只需掌握几个关键操作组合:
- 方向键导航:在页面元素间移动焦点
- 确认键执行:激活当前焦点元素的操作
- 长按返回键:关闭当前浏览标签页
- 菜单键调用:打开标签页管理界面
- 语音按钮激活:启动语音搜索功能
TV Bro深色主题界面显示维基百科化学词条,同时打开多个标签页,适合长时间阅读
🏠 五大应用场景展现电视浏览新价值
1. 家庭数字娱乐中心
TV Bro将电视转变为完整的娱乐平台:
- 流媒体聚合平台:访问各类视频网站,无需安装多个独立应用
- 在线游戏体验区:享受大屏网页游戏的沉浸式体验
- 音乐流媒体播放器:直接播放各类音乐平台内容
- 社交媒体浏览终端:舒适地浏览社交平台内容
2. 教育与远程学习助手
大屏幕为学习提供了得天独厚的优势:
- 在线课程观看平台:慕课平台课程内容清晰呈现
- 文档阅读器:PDF、电子书阅读体验显著提升
- 协作工具访问终端:直接使用在线协作平台
- 语言学习辅助工具:访问各类语言学习网站资源
3. 智能家居控制中枢
通过TV Bro,电视成为家庭物联网管理平台:
- 网络设备管理界面:访问路由器、NAS等设备管理页面
- 安防监控查看终端:实时查看摄像头监控画面
- 智能家电控制面板:网页控制智能灯光、空调等设备
- 家庭自动化管理中心:访问智能家居控制平台
4. 商务演示与协作工具
在商业环境中,TV Bro同样发挥重要作用:
- 在线演示平台:直接展示网页版演示文稿
- 数据可视化展示:大屏展示报表和数据分析图表
- 远程会议参与终端:访问视频会议平台
- 团队协作工作区:使用在线白板和协作工具
5. 老年友好型上网方案
针对老年用户群体,TV Bro提供了特别优化:
- 大字显示模式:确保视力不佳用户也能清晰阅读
- 简化导航流程:减少操作步骤,降低使用门槛
- 语音辅助功能:降低文字输入的难度
- 常用网站快捷入口:一键访问健康资讯、新闻等高频内容
🔧 技术架构与优化策略深度解析
标签页智能管理机制
TV Bro的标签页系统不仅仅是简单的页面堆叠,它包含了智能内存管理机制。当标签页数量增加时,系统会自动优化资源分配,确保前台标签页获得最佳性能,同时将后台标签页适度休眠以节省资源。
遥控器事件处理优化
项目采用了先进的输入事件处理机制,将遥控器的有限按键映射为丰富的浏览器操作。通过长按、组合键等设计,实现了远超按键数量的功能覆盖。
渲染引擎适配策略
TV Bro充分利用Android系统的内置渲染引擎,通过优化配置参数,在兼容性和性能之间找到了最佳平衡点。这种设计确保了浏览器能够流畅运行在各种配置的电视设备上。
TV Bro品牌视觉设计突出电视浏览器的核心定位,简洁现代的蓝色背景与白色文字形成鲜明对比
🛠️ 常见问题诊断与性能优化方案
性能优化实用策略
如果遇到浏览器运行缓慢的情况,可以尝试以下优化措施:
内存管理优化技巧
- 定期清理浏览数据:进入设置→隐私与安全→清除浏览数据
- 合理控制标签页数量:建议同时打开的标签页不超过8个
- 关闭不必要的扩展功能
网络加速配置方法
- 启用广告拦截功能,减少不必要的内容加载
- 调整缓存设置,平衡速度和存储空间
- 检查DNS设置,使用更快的DNS服务器
故障诊断实用指南
视频播放异常处理方案
- 检查网络连接稳定性
- 更新浏览器到最新版本
- 确认视频格式兼容性
- 调整硬件加速设置
遥控器响应延迟解决方案
- 检查电视系统资源占用情况
- 调整TV Bro的遥控器灵敏度设置
- 重启电视和浏览器应用
- 确保遥控器电池电量充足
网页显示异常应对措施
- 尝试切换用户代理模式
- 清除特定网站的Cookie和缓存
- 检查网页兼容性设置
- 更新系统WebView组件
🤝 参与开源社区,共同塑造电视浏览未来
TV Bro作为一个开源项目,其持续发展离不开社区的积极参与。无论您是普通用户还是技术开发者,都可以为项目的发展贡献力量。
��户参与途径
- 使用体验反馈:分享您的使用感受和改进建议
- 问题报告协助:遇到问题时详细描述复现步骤
- 新版本功能测试:参与测试新版本的功能特性
- 多语言翻译支持:协助完善项目的国际化支持
项目架构概览
项目采用清晰的模块化架构,便于理解和贡献:
- 核心功能模块:位于
app/common/src/main/java/com/phlox/tvwebbrowser/ - Web引擎实现:位于
app/gecko/src/main/java/com/phlox/tvwebbrowser/webengine/gecko/ - 用户界面组件:位于
app/src/main/java/com/phlox/tvwebbrowser/activity/ - 资源文件管理:包含多语言字符串和布局配置文件
未来发展方向规划
根据项目路线图,TV Bro将持续改进以下方面:
- 提升隐私浏览模式的稳定性
- 优化缓存管理机制
- 完善鼠标和触摸支持
- 增强多语言本地化覆盖
- 改进性能监控和调试工具
💡 开启智能电视的全新可能性
TV Bro不仅仅是一个浏览器应用,它是连接智能电视与广阔互联网世界的桥梁。通过精心设计的遥控器交互、智能的资源管理和持续的性能优化,TV Bro解决了电视上网的核心痛点——操作不便。
在这个信息高度互联的时代,电视不应只是被动的娱乐接收设备,而应成为主动的信息获取工具。TV Bro让这一愿景成为现实,让每个家庭都能通过电视轻松访问丰富的网络资源。
无论您是寻求家庭娱乐解决方案、教育辅助工具,还是智能家居控制中心,TV Bro都能提供出色的使用体验。开源的本质意味着这个项目将持续进化,吸收社区智慧,不断适应新的用户需求和技术发展。
现在,就为您的智能电视安装TV Bro,开启全新的大屏上网体验吧!让电视真正发挥其"智能"潜力,成为家庭数字生活的核心枢纽。
【免费下载链接】tv-broSimple web browser for android optimized to use with TV remote项目地址: https://gitcode.com/gh_mirrors/tv/tv-bro
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考